Is It Possible To Remove Popcorn Ceilings?

So that they are just regular flat surfaces instead of the crappy popcorn effect they have?

Anyone know how to go about doing this if it is possible?

go buy a huge roll of plastic for your carpet/hardwood floor tape it all the way up the wall. go get your hose with a nossle and set it to mist. go over the ceiling completely with water. let soak in for 20 minutes. then come back and spray it once more. it'll start to fall off. then go get one of those flat metal scraper thingies. scrape all that shit off and bam your done. it's a bitch and a mess but thats what you need to do. if you painted over that popcorn shit i think your fucked.

Good Luck with that project. It totally sucks, but the end results are well worth it. If you do it yourself, make sure you wear a mask. The stuff does have some asbestos in it. Be careful how you get rid of it too. If you hire someone to do it for you, make sure their quote includes the disposal of it....(voice of experience)
